U.S. district Judge Kathryn Kimball Mizelle in Tampa, Florida has ordered that the transportation mask mandate from the CDC is now void. The CDC (Centers for Disease Control and Prevention) recently extended their transportation mask mandate through May 3, 2022. Orange County, Florida Mayor Jerry Demings announced that he is lifting all COVID-19 restrictions, including mask mandates and physical distancing, effective tomorrow, Saturday, June 5, 2021. Orange County Mayor Jerry Demings addressed the latest COVID-19 data in a press release today. The county has maintained a 14-day COVID positivity rate of 4.7%. Orange County Mayor Jerry Demings confirmed this afternoon that the remaining mask mandate will stay in place. Some thought the mandate might be lifted early since The Department of Health had reported an average of 4.4%. However, now Orange County has reached a 14-day COVID-19 positivity rate of 5.2%.
